A five-time winner of awards from the Association of Jazz and Modern Music as best pianist and/or keyboards player, Joan Díaz surprised audiences and critics alike four years ago with We Sing Bill Evans. He followed this album with Benestar/Peaceful, his first solo piano effort in which he teams up with Perico Sambeat (2010). Díaz has worked with a long list of ensembles and has recorded with musicians like Randy Brecker, Michael Mossman, John Mosca, Robin Eubanks, Dennis Rowland, Theo Bleckman, Chris Kase, Allan Skidmore, Jorge Rossy, Peer Wyboris, Jordi Bonell, Juan Mungía, Adam Colker, Bob Sands, Perico Sambeat, Chris Higgins, Omer Avital, Gary Willis, Jeff Fuczinsky, Kirk Covington, Armand Sabal·lecco, Horacio “El Negro”, Gonzalo Rubalcaba, Dick Oatts and many more.  Particularly interesting are his latest collaboration with flamenco guitarist Niño Josele and his work as an arranger of Evans’ music for big band, as well as his partnership with director Cesc Gay, which has led him to compose the soundtracks for such films as Hotel Room, In the City and V.O.S.
